This week’s Blender challenge was a fun one, and pretty personal too. I’ve been diving deeper into 3D printing lately, with the goal of launching some products on my Etsy store soon. So, I thought it’d be the perfect time to take on a modeling project using a tool that’s already playing a big role in my workflow, the Bambu Labs X1 Carbon 3D printer.

I used the printer itself as a reference for the entire process, modeling and texturing everything directly in Blender. It was a great exercise in working from real-world geometry and trying to capture those little design details that make the X1 Carbon so sleek.

X1 Carbon Blender Render

Once the model was complete, I brought it into Unreal Engine 5 to test out some lighting setups and get a feel for how it might look in a product showcase scene.
